#58dac7 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#58dac7 is composed of 34.5% red, 85.5% green and 78%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.7%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 171.2 degrees, a saturation of 63.7% and a lightness of 60%. #58dac7 color hex could be obtained by blending #b0ffff with #00b58f.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#58dac7
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020a09 is the darkest color, while #f9fefd is the lightest one.
